When sending GetDocument()->UpdateAllViews alle views are flickering once. Can anybody tell me how to disable that flickering? Do I have to modify OnUpdate? I tried to do something with InvalidateRect but it does not solve my problem.
Best regards,
Peter

It seems you have put also window controls onto view. Again, I prone to say that in that case the controls are also redrawn (not updated). This may take some time too.
You should provide more info on what you are doing to let us to be more concrete. Anyway, you should update not entire view but a part of it. You'd rather set a mask parameter into UpdateAllViews and get it from CView::OnUpdate method, then update the necessary part of a view.

I created a class CCamera using Insert->New Class MFC with the base class CView.
I made the constructor and destructor public(they were protected when created).I declared a static int varialble CamCounter in Camera.h. I included Camera.h in a DialogClass and tried to use the static variable CCamera::cameraCount in Dialog Class.
But it gave a link error
error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ol "public: static int CCamera::cameraCount"
What could be reason behind this?
|
|
|
|
|
did you #include the file needed ?
|
|
|
|
|
did you initialize it in the Camera.cpp file like this
int CCamera::cameraCount = 0;
